Is Helmex safe in G6PD deficiency?
Helmex is a medication that is considered safe for individuals with G6PD deficiency G6PD deficiency is a genetic condition that affects the red blood cells and can cause them to break down more easily It is important however to consult with your doctor to determine if Helmex or any other medications should be avoided in individuals with G6PD deficiency G6PD deficiency is a relatively common condition particularly in certain populations such as individuals of African Mediterranean or Middle Eastern descent It is important for individuals with this deficiency to be aware of any medications or substances that may trigger a hemolytic crisis a condition where the red blood cells break down rapidly Some medications such as certain antibiotics and pain relievers can potentially cause this reaction in individuals with G6PD deficiency Therefore it is crucial to consult a healthcare professional who can provide specific guidance regarding the use of medications in individuals with G6PD deficiency They will be able to provide personalized advice based on the individuals medical history the severity of their G6PD deficiency and any other factors that may impact their treatment options In summary while Helmex is generally safe for use in individuals with G6PD deficiency it is important to seek guidance from a healthcare professional to ensure the safest and most appropriate treatment
